Firebase/Firestore聊天应用的数据模型

4
这是我用于测试聊天应用程序的当前Firebase/Firestore数据模型。但是,这个模型在Android平台上很难用于推送通知。我想在用户从他们所在的任何频道接收消息时向他们的手机发送推送通知。此外,需要添加文件/图像消息。
你有什么建议或好的聊天应用程序数据模型示例可以参考吗?
Firestore数据模型如下图所示: Firestore data model

您可以参考 https://firebase.google.com/docs/functions/use-cases#notify_users_when_something_interesting_happens。 - Sushant Somani
我希望编写一个后台服务来监听 Channel 数据的快照,然后在 Android 上创建通知。这种方法有问题吗? - Patola
1个回答

9

如果你想尝试另一种云 Firestore 数据库架构方法,你可以在这里找到一个教程,讲解如何为聊天应用程序 设计数据库

我在另一个教程中逐步讲解了如何使用 Cloud FirestoreNode.js 向特定用户发送通知。你也可以查看我在这个post中的回答。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接